A Reuters/Ipsos poll shows President Trump's approval rating hovering near his political low, with 35% approving of his performance. A majority (59%) of Americans expect gasoline prices to worsen over the next year due to the Iran conflict, and disapproval of his handling of living costs stands at 70%.
